Why Are Cash Buyers and Home Investors Popular Choices for Sellers in Dallas TX?

Cash buyers and home investors are people or businesses that purchase properties outright, without relying on buyer financing such as mortgage loans. This basic difference offers several main advantages over traditional sales.

    Speedy Sale: Since cash buyers do not rely on loan approvals, sales close much faster—often within several days to a handful of weeks instead of long months. Cash Bids: Cash offers provide greater certainty because there is no risk of the deal falling through due to financing issues. Ease of Sale: The simplified selling process involves fewer contingencies and less paperwork, reducing stress for sellers. Reasonable Offers: Trusted investors base offers on present market conditions and home value, guaranteeing competitive prices matching local data. Adaptable Contract Conditions: Sellers often have more ability to bargain over closing schedules and other clauses.

Choosing cash buyers in Dallas TX streamlines the selling process and appeals especially to those seeking a hassle-free, fast transaction.

How Does Selling a House “As-Is” to Real Estate Investors Save Money on Repairs?

One of the major financial benefits of selling to home investors is the ability to sell your property “as-is.” This means you are not needed to perform any home repairs, remodeling, or cosmetic upgrades before closing.

    Zero Repair Expenses: Investors acquire homes irrespective of their state, protecting sellers from pricey renovation costs. Avoid Home Inspection Re-Negotiations: Since buyers are aware of the property’s existing condition, you skip delays or price reductions resulting from inspection findings. Ideal for Distressed Properties: Sellers with previously owned, defective, or outdated houses gain by avoiding the costly and time-consuming home staging and repair steps. Eliminates Remodeling Hassles: No need to arrange contractors, permits, or project management.

This “as-is sale” approach is especially favorable for owners of distressed or inherited properties who want to avoid further investment in their home before selling.

What Financial Savings Can Homeowners Expect by Selling to Investors?

Selling to investors often generates significant financial savings compared to traditional real estate transactions.

    No Commissions: You avoid paying realtor fees, which typically use 5-6% of the sale price. Lower Closing Costs: Many investors assume or contribute to customary transaction fees including title transfer and legal fees. Reduced Transaction Fees: Streamlined sales cause fewer administrative expenses. Avoid Property Appraisal Delays: Investor deals commonly do not call for appraisal contingencies, stopping unexpected appraisal-related costs or delays. Clear Title and Lien Resolution: Experienced investors manage issues related to property liens, delivering smoother title transfers at closing.

Overall, these savings increase your net proceeds, making investor sales economically attractive.

How Flexible Is the Closing Process When Selling to a Home Investor?

The ability to regulate your closing timeline is a major plus when working with home investors in Dallas.

    Flexible Closing Dates: Close in as little as 7 to 14 days or prolong to several weeks according to need. Foreclosure Avoidance: Quick closings assist sellers avoid foreclosure by providing immediate cash solutions. Accommodation for Relocation: If moving for a job or personal reasons, adjustable terms let you to coordinate house sale with your schedule. Bargaining Strength: Vendors often can modify contract conditions to fit particular scenarios or desires.

The flexibility lowers the typical stress associated with standard 30-60 day closings and aids sellers handle significant changes easily.

Are Tax and Financial Planning Concerns Relevant When Selling to Home Investors?

While the sale itself is financially beneficial, recognizing likely tax implications and strategic planning is important.

    Tax Implications: Capital gains taxes might be imposed if your home’s value has risen; consult a tax advisor to comprehend liabilities. Mortgage Payoff: Rapid sales facilitate timely mortgage settlement, preventing additional interest or penalties. Property Taxes: Ensure outstanding property taxes are settled during closing to stop future liabilities. Financial Planning: Think about relocation expenses or reinvestment of proceeds as part of your post-sale strategy.

Proper financial planning helps you get the most from benefits and limit surprises after selling your home to an investor.
